Syntowax H 32G is a compound for investment casting. It is a composition of purified waxes, resins, polymers and organic fillers.
Package: PP bags 20 kg each.
Storage: it should be stored in a closed dry warehouse, excluding direct sunlight, at a temperature no higher than 40 ° C, relative humidity — no more than 80%.

Application:
For casting on smelted models of complex configuration.
Features:
- good mold occupancy;
- high fluidity;
- low adhesion to the press mold surface;
- high strength characteristics;
- good elasticity;
- small and stable shrinkage;
- minimum ash content;
- high solidification rate

P24M10 is a micronized polypropylene wax, representing a universal high-temperature additive with a melting point of 146–152 °C, compatible with most coating systems, including solvent-based, powder, epoxy, polyester, acrylic, and UV-curable coatings. Its key function is the formation of a strong and hard protective surface layer that significantly enhances the coating’s resistance to abrasive wear and scratching. At the same time, the wax acts as a highly effective matting agent, providing a uniform, stable, and deep matte finish.
Thanks to its chemical inertness and high melting point, P24M10 remains stable within formulations and during service without negatively affecting other film properties. It is used in protective, industrial, and decorative coatings where increased surface wear resistance, resistance to mechanical damage, and a stable matte appearance are required.

Micronized waxes are used as additives in the production of coatings and surface finishes. They improve gloss and slip properties, promote effective resin dispersion, and form a smooth surface layer that protects against scratching and abrasion.
They are used in powder coatings, architectural paints, and wood coatings.
